Laney BCC-BLACKHEATH TRI MODE BASS DISTORTION

The Laney BCC-BLACKHEATH is a compact, roadworthy bass distortion pedal housed in a rugged metal chassis that feels solid underfoot. Its tri-mode architecture delivers three distinct distortion characters—accessible via the dedicated overdrive switch—letting you dial in anything from subtle grit to aggressive saturation without leaving the pedalboard. The efficient footprint and intuitive control layout make this a practical choice for bassists working in confined spaces or demanding live rigs.

Tone & Electronics

Three distortion modes expand your sonic palette across genres and playing styles, while the color and dist controls sculpt the character and intensity of each mode. Transparent, fully buffered operation preserves your bass's natural tone and cuts through the mix with ultra-low noise circuitry and silent switching, ensuring clean signal integrity in any setup.

Design & Build

Built into a compact metal enclosure measuring 58.5 x 74 x 121.5 mm, the pedal operates on a single 9V battery or optional 9V DC PSU (centre negative, 2.1x10mm connector). The tri-coloured LED clearly indicates which mode is active, giving you instant visual feedback on stage or in the studio.

Key Features

  • Tri-Mode Bass distortion with three distinct distortion characters
  • Controls: Gain, Range, Volume, Color, Dist 1, Dist 2, and Overdrive mode switch
  • 1/4" jack input and output connectors
  • 9V battery or 9V DC PSU power (PSU not included)
  • Centre negative, 2.1x10mm power supply connector
  • Metal housing for durability and reliability
  • Transparent, fully buffered signal path with ultra-low noise circuitry
  • Silent switching for seamless mode transitions
  • Tri-coloured LED mode indicator
  • Compact dimensions: 58.5 x 74 x 121.5 mm (2.3 x 2.9 x 4.8 inches)
  • Lightweight at 0.38 kg (0.8 lb)
  • Black and green finish

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the three distortion modes, and how do I switch between them?

The three modes are accessed via a dedicated overdrive switch and deliver distinct distortion characters ranging from subtle grit to aggressive saturation. A tri-coloured LED indicator shows which mode is active, allowing you to see your selection instantly on stage or in the studio.

What controls does the pedal have?

The BCC-BLACKHEATH features Gain, Range, Volume, Color, Dist 1, Dist 2, and an Overdrive mode switch. The Color and Dist controls let you sculpt the character and intensity of each mode to fit your playing style and genre.

Does this pedal work with battery power, and what are the power options?

Yes, the pedal operates on a single 9V battery or an optional 9V DC PSU (centre negative, 2.1x10mm connector). The PSU is not included but can be added separately for permanent installations.

How does the signal path preserve my bass tone?

The pedal features a transparent, fully buffered signal path with ultra-low noise circuitry and silent switching, ensuring clean signal integrity and preventing tone loss or unwanted noise in your rig.
